Facility Information
Sea Island Community Centre is located in Burkeville on Miller Road, which diverts off the north end of Russ Baker Way. 

Facilities include a community hall and playground. The Community Association also makes use of the Sea Island School gymnasium and utilizes the nearby tennis courts and Burkeville Park facilities.
